Transaction 80d29b16c54b5bd168f2bb95687744848c0d012dd18846db2211124f309b7804
3 Input
2 Outputs
- 80d29b16c54b5bd168f2bb95687744848c0d012dd18846db2211124f309b7804:0
- 80d29b16c54b5bd168f2bb95687744848c0d012dd18846db2211124f309b7804:1
value 168073
address 3EzCa5iwFVwu9B1mUwnaKATBRCT9kj13eB
value 177145
address 1KCFMMgifdwN4omdSTQU9KUf7VR1MY2Zw5